Output dd3d58db28ac4f6ff9603a6d47946260bf096f081e1e5170737ce2158c513f72:0

value
85074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8e84d84c53cf451c9e61977c5520a3b122e75c OP_EQUAL
address
37DDCSbYWEfQ8g2r8PrmMfaiuBtEvFGBsX
transaction
dd3d58db28ac4f6ff9603a6d47946260bf096f081e1e5170737ce2158c513f72